Personally Controlled Electronic Health Records (Consequential Amendments) Act 2012
No. 64, 2012
An Act to make amendments consequential on the enactment of the Personally Controlled Electronic Health Records Act 2012, and for related purposes

The Parliament of Australia enacts:
1 Short title This Act may be cited as the Personally Controlled Electronic Health Records (Consequential Amendments) Act 2012.
2 Commencement (1) Each provision of this Act specified in column 1 of the table commences, or is taken to have commenced, in accordance with column 2 of the table. Any other statement in column 2 has effect according to its terms.
Commencement information Column 1 Column 2 Column 3 Provision(s) Commencement Date/Details 1. Sections 1 to 3 and anything in this Act not elsewhere covered by this table The day this Act receives the Royal Assent. 26 June 2012 2. Schedule 1 A day or days to be fixed by Proclamation. 29 June 2012 However, if any of the provision(s) do not commence by the later of: (see F2012L01398) (a) 1 July 2012; and (b) the day this Act receives the Royal Assent; they commence on the day after the later of those days.
